Bares für Rares Heute (Today): A Nation's Fascination with History and Value

*Bares für Rares heute* (today’s *Bares für Rares*) continues to dominate German television schedules. Its success hinges on several key factors. Firstly, the show taps into a deep-seated national interest in history and heritage. Many Germans possess family heirlooms or antique items with sentimental value, and *Bares für Rares* provides a platform to uncover their potential worth and perhaps even sell them for a significant profit. This resonates deeply with a broad audience, attracting viewers from all walks of life.

Secondly, the show's format is engaging and accessible. The process of appraisal, negotiation, and ultimately, the sale, is presented in a clear and compelling manner. The experts, with their specialized knowledge and often-passionate explanations, make the often complex world of antiques understandable and enjoyable for the average viewer. The dealers, each with their own distinct personality and negotiating style, add another layer of entertainment, creating a dynamic and unpredictable element to each episode. This combination of education and entertainment is a key ingredient in the show's enduring popularity.

Thirdly, the human element is crucial. The stories behind the objects are often as fascinating as the items themselves. Viewers connect with the sellers, empathizing with their reasons for selling and sharing in their excitement (or disappointment) at the final sale price. This emotional connection forms a strong bond between the show and its audience, fostering a sense of community and shared experience. The show isn't just about money; it's about stories, memories, and the tangible links to the past.

The Allure of Rare Rolex Watches on Bares für Rares

While the show features a vast array of items, rare and vintage Rolex watches frequently appear, generating considerable excitement. Rolex watches represent more than just timekeeping devices; they are iconic symbols of luxury, prestige, and enduring craftsmanship. Their value often appreciates significantly over time, making them attractive investments. The appearance of a rare Rolex model on *Bares für Rares* is a guaranteed highlight, drawing in viewers eager to witness the appraisal process and the subsequent bidding war among the dealers. The scarcity of certain models, combined with their historical significance and impeccable reputation, ensures that they command high prices, often exceeding the expectations of even the most seasoned appraisers.
